Plantain a member of the banana family, they are traditionally larger in size and lower in sugar than bananas. They come in two varieties โ either unripe (or green), or ripe. Both must be cooked before eating. Unripe plantains are starchy and almost bread-like in texture with a bland flavour. Ripe plantains with their black and yellow skin are stickier and sweeter.
